Job Description
• Lead substation protection and control engineering projects, partnering with design engineers and drafters to ensure high-quality deliverables are submitted on time.
• Create and modify design documents and drawings, including electric substation one-lines, three-lines, control schematics, wiring diagrams, relay panel arrangements and specifications, conduit and cable sizing/routing, and bills of material.
• Design auxiliary AC and DC power systems.
• Develop SCADA systems and communications interfaces.
• Collaborate with multidisciplinary project teams to fully integrate protection, control, automation, and monitoring systems.
• Perform engineering calculations such as relay burden, voltage drop, short circuit studies, battery sizing, auxiliary AC and DC load tabulations, and other analyses required to support project success.
• Perform relay coordination studies and prepare relay settings.
• Conduct engineering and technical quality reviews of deliverables prepared by other engineers and designers.
• Perform site walk-downs to independently scope project requirements as needed.
• Coordinate material procurement and delivery to project sites.
• Support Project Managers throughout the project lifecycle, including participating in client calls and meetings and assisting with project execution needs.
• Contribute to the development of project cost estimates for substation protection and control projects, including planning, engineering/design, construction, and testing components.
